Game Overview

A quiet island turns into a tense nightly siege when the undead grow faster, sharper, and far more determined after dark. Survive the Nights is an open-world first-person survival game built around practical preparation rather than constant run-and-gun action: daylight is for scavenging, while darkness is for defending what you have secured. Its post-outbreak setting feels deliberately harsh, with food, medical supplies, shelter, and ammunition all carrying real value. The mood is cautious and grounded, rewarding players who think ahead instead of treating every abandoned house as a shooting gallery.

Days revolve around searching towns, homes, and wilderness areas for the tools needed to last another night. Players can occupy existing buildings, then reinforce entrances, arrange defenses, place traps, manage fires, cook meals, and keep bandages ready before the sun sets. Zombies remain a threat in daylight but are generally slower and less aggressive, creating a useful window for travel and looting; nighttime turns them into active hunters that arrive in greater numbers and punish anyone caught outside. Survival supports solo play, but cooperation is central to the design, as a group can divide jobs between scouting, gathering, building, cooking, and guarding a fortified position.

What separates Survive the Nights from more arcade-like zombie sandboxes is its emphasis on adapting real structures rather than simply erecting a base anywhere on the map. A modest house can become a defensible refuge if players understand sightlines, entrances, supplies, and the value of staying indoors when conditions worsen. The day-and-night rhythm gives every expedition a purpose and makes a successful return before sundown genuinely satisfying.
